SAE International unveils new scholarly journal on transportation safety -

Engineers and technical experts association SAE International has announced the availability of a new scholarly journal focusing on accident prevention and occupant protection – specifically accident reconstruction, injury investigation, intra-vehicle safety mechanisms, and mitigation related to human travel. NLM’s History of Medicine Division launches new blog ‘Circulating Now’ -

The National Library of Medicine (NLM) has announced that its History of Medicine Division has launched a new blog, Circulating Now, to encourage greater exploration and discovery of one of the world's largest and most treasured history of medicine collections.
